Output 91d3255ef7f6c301597c0a1e0d7d1dc7b2ec6caef91c78170d16259895cead86:1

value
253653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3db259f390c3760bf75f43e4ab46e93eca9f65 OP_EQUAL
address
3QbTSTHa68wHcwkjRdmajbhpkzAKNb1HCn
transaction
91d3255ef7f6c301597c0a1e0d7d1dc7b2ec6caef91c78170d16259895cead86
spent
true